This is a beautiful campground that is lightly wooded and well spaced. The office folks were very helpful at check in. I booked on the national website so that is easy. There are lots of amenities including playgrounds, jump pad, volleyball, tetherball, axe throwing and nice restrooms as well as a trail to a waterfall. Every site has a picnic table and fire pit/grill. Ours had nice chairs as well. Most sites are pull through. The store is well stocked. Nearby recreational activities include the Rogue River and Redwood Forest. AT&T has good reception (3 bars) that is enough for streaming. No antenna reception or cable. The camp WiFi is slow and incapable of streaming. There is wildlife roaming through the camp including turkeys and deer.

This small RV park (39 sites) has been here many years but just recently became a KOA. It is away from town and on a road with other privately owned property...no industrial activities or businesses of any kind.
We've never stayed at a KOA that had so many trees and separate hook areas, not to mention, creek with waterfalls and swimming holes. Our spot #18 has its own deck with table and chairs (see pic).
We think the best sites, some right over the creek, are numbers 1 thru 19. It actually felt like we were in more of state park than a RV campground.
